From a538e3369afcce84d351c53ca24484ebcc444326 Mon Sep 17 00:00:00 2001
From: Jan-Christoph Borchardt <JanCBorchardt@fsfe.org>
Date: Sun, 17 Apr 2011 12:20:28 +0200
Subject: [PATCH] moved help from meta navigation to 'settings' (still need a
 good name for it). Also, even more hip new mono icons

---
 css/styles.css             |   4 ++--
 help/appinfo/app.php       |   3 ++-
 img/layout/back.png        | Bin 257 -> 396 bytes
 img/layout/help.png        | Bin 354 -> 0 bytes
 img/layout/logout.png      | Bin 446 -> 657 bytes
 img/layout/settings.png    | Bin 435 -> 695 bytes
 templates/layout.admin.php |   7 +++----
 templates/layout.user.php  |   8 ++------
 8 files changed, 9 insertions(+), 13 deletions(-)
 delete mode 100644 img/layout/help.png

diff --git a/css/styles.css b/css/styles.css
index 9d0a710adb..93829b7ef9 100644
--- a/css/styles.css
+++ b/css/styles.css
@@ -35,10 +35,10 @@ body.login p.info { width:16em; margin:4em auto; padding:1em; background-color:#
 #login input[type=submit] { width:5em; border:1px solid #ddd; background-color:#fff; font-size:2em; }
 #login input[type=submit]:hover, #login input[type=submit]:focus { background-color:#ccc; outline:0; }
 
-/* USER MENU ---------------------------------------------------------------- */ 
+/* META NAVIGATION (Settings, Log out) ---------------------------------------------------------------- */ 
 #metanav { float:right; position:relative; top:1.5em; list-style:none; margin:0; padding:0; }
 #metanav li { display:inline; }
-#metanav li a { padding:1em; }
+#metanav li a { margin:.1em; padding:1em; }
 #metanav li a:hover, #metanav li a:focus { background:rgba(0,0,0,.5); -moz-border-radius:5px; -webkit-border-radius:5px; border-radius:5px; outline:0; box-shadow:#444 0 1px 0; -moz-box-shadow:#444 0 1px 0; -webkit-box-shadow:#444 0 1px 0; }
 #metanav li a img { vertical-align:middle; }
 
diff --git a/help/appinfo/app.php b/help/appinfo/app.php
index 661b554f41..c4e9eb5717 100644
--- a/help/appinfo/app.php
+++ b/help/appinfo/app.php
@@ -1,5 +1,6 @@
 <?php
 
-OC_APP::register( array( "id" => "help", "name" => "Help" ));
+OC_APP::register( array( "order" => 1, "id" => "help", "name" => "Help" ));
+OC_APP::addSettingsPage( array( "order" => 2, "href" => OC_HELPER::linkTo( "help", "index.php" ), "name" => "Help", "icon" => OC_HELPER::imagePath( "admin", "navicon.png" )));
 
 ?>
diff --git a/img/layout/back.png b/img/layout/back.png
index 900ae719adce3a4da03c8cb58d9c637be8eb1540..86abbe0cabe37a4b47f32241b5f327bc346f98ce 100644
GIT binary patch
delta 344
zcmZo<>S3N>TQ9$ofkA#Hqi%ep2Ll5Gdx@v7EBkF0K`v%%yPfad85kHPJzX3_EKYBo
zywU53gFsvQG+ie5tZeSU4be3W+}$GE!n@uptn__zsoSnGLrPv@ZLY#Kvz09lvtpct
zCY^oP=j+G+g{S;@?T5{Wb^f0}V8HPEh(z(et&y6gnLU}?jOx8L^V<?LrUY%-xbyvQ
zcFk1%r7D_FQyBERx8<gH{OITiPo975de2vVozstG7#6(V#k};2t<t&U_EDVa|9uZI
zFnqGvpW1WwCA*5!j7#MW?|;89l&Lp57LeT=m3=Ad@RYEboQmrfYy8qUJxQ$lXwb4%
zTB~0F@@HiDV7S0@(vzEofpfIF7FjDE(Nr=zXIVAxdsByW?k6Rl!`pREhXjhSFdSzn
z*yNUN$=&q8)HnFnQ<1)y>$SID&d9lK*HZhL_3^4pR&uQKH!v_TFnGH9xvX<aXaWG|
CaFzc6

delta 204
zcmeBSZe*HZTQ9wyfkApbW1Q4P83qOh_7YEDSN7X10)kS!htB*kVqjqC^K@|xu{gc;
z@<LuFM*)Y64^^0aofsozd<D367!`DAGqt-+xWLqAR$#)w<|$xvW@3)t-Mk&||NEDv
zt0j3n`>GkR_~bOhgMr@b_8jqbir;uhEMNB53FDYA&u5;>wsB4QG`akThJw<fU#ItM
zJhb-(r)Nr6@kMpDiGpSosr?&;qaH-bWGE-U>1LiQYspi#G2T0As_)^l1&<jR7#KWV
L{an^LB{Ts5x2{l+

diff --git a/img/layout/help.png b/img/layout/help.png
deleted file mode 100644
index bf29c09f8c171eaff20d4fd4983aa1b32f54a027..0000000000000000000000000000000000000000
GIT binary patch
literal 0
HcmV?d00001

literal 354
zcmeAS@N?(olHy`uVBq!ia0y~yU=RRd4mJh`2Kmqb6B!s7*pj^6T^Rm@;DWu&Co?cG
za29w(7Bes~?gn8-t2d7yF)%Q&mw5WRvfpMA5R}qOSl#Ksz`*d{)5S5w;`GwVj($vz
z0<QN34sSSmvw+Fwh)mN|&RwO>dxW!X*gBU_uvK*9l<qM$dbU~9C-B=0i$6=m?#6!I
zz3bn5AED_Brr$W-=>9-5f^q!;p&5)v*XMZJsZBD=I=*|!rRzT)1qHp`{5|xr`&|K#
ztlckq78rc%xLkR}ElBTWI@|V>-y3z5+zvF$KZ<2%e8;#h$IwqDW#QzG?E44TE&aRS
z;0w!bKL3i3EZux8{`Wj~F8OMoQe*tGQ*VvX(TPhw<@I<j-MBsRZLCJ8&PQo(<7*;2
z3|qIEEw>DqpZS*K*MS4Bd3G-u?;l|N!KBsgzrd2|3xBDTU?Jl?1_lNOPgg&ebxsLQ
E02e%v5dZ)H

diff --git a/img/layout/logout.png b/img/layout/logout.png
index 0ee7e1b14cd38dd869f46ebefdca8f293c6bb9d6..74dcd33bee7b1bd0d502068f570e300fa0f4d9ce 100644
GIT binary patch
delta 607
zcmdnTJdt&RZ9VUG1_s{ij7}P}D;O9U*h@TpUD<E52y!Zm&t5DU&%nSW=jq}YVsUzI
z@cwKON0EPbBrLx$-I7@%H06j>-;|{3e^?!p1cFXZl?!v*ap;MY)<&Ov*^M2VN4_P9
z2XXvUD44LjdG$NKw6Zeu;_WB@&8akdx5+Yz$!^A@+V{2ht3TI2<1J{-T+6@pTKtFo
zV#f`S7W#xgm2hqE$P>EgtrW$?uvBD9P~;m;!CZlhz1~whGVFXWzxUFV>ObDj@Zh)I
z&wc(31!ZMrOQtBT{c5hX%h-1w@8J*WlT@y}|K7fO_3BcF2|<&lOk!9Nw%XM4dE6uw
zk+z4|x##+*O}-u|61e@gY<-B<)NqD(j17-1o>=&qHUG@o`m4|InQNfS^XJdAcQPcu
zvEX1@b^Y~w#xrRa&*xY?KdLxw_St906*xK!)1I!FV)V&IUu&w@_wMk`I;*oI!<KjG
z>gnnA9)EnL^sXl#mm<^o&yVKLl}*mt_L^Z{Jj1o?`IYmg?^q}O?7_*CCj-1Z>$m0F
z@5(c`c+MT<^{T|`a1H;hx8L&DnjSK!DW2;f;+ntp+KaDMZ)IX4BO{Z0RGm0fTPnWk
zZ+g8;+KJ<=g!i=R)8j>wpSmsn*jc>J^7+c#+wv00{9Nn51aNFTZs~9Nyed2UwQ<9z
zlE&k^ckgard{HB<=i>e1QxcPB+Dq^}diyrwEi=Q_9+O~!4bf}Ej+>la5VTUFxVTvL
zutDDPOe^J<0^iGjw(i_nxnckQ{p=4clw-dczGJFjN?3Sd8OsIM56lNL4S({hvKG7&
U(!B7Cfq{X+)78&qol`;+05)P7T>t<8

delta 395
zcmbQpx{rB+ZN2n*1_tT%jB!#EWf&M3*h@TpUD<E52nb4ROt>s-!oa}j?djqeVsU!v
z<^5Sx0tHw<-2eM6*}R@h*)zmL&{Hu=^9M&|L&J?FA6S{n!uB<WZs26xxY2a#QvZc>
zr%j4b(bCA6()#t*oL27$6>9^7;`eini_f1CS+P|w;cCsNwNvUpEm!%W`)={>ln*TL
zH^yeIjsDT`*i!q(fw_F%5($=7UGq2AyH5Wo9Y3p_S*P?x^NtSx8^;6xq+fL1bBxjN
zk@Nk;7NH~4PyUl|?pf^o<{^9B)7*m@TnbC)Jz@;|^dhSy>-__s=be&Y9jEj46z+a`
z%<B!GX!OG*#q`5=FD4~6ov-ITaF@+tp8?-TgBP>6mF(yguaKzUzVm;#bI!KUMTG_P
z)DOp<m~+Z<-m|>@yf5?_dOooAe_*+O`0)3dw<{ED)fi$pPe|IeERK$tZ`xPeF<bTe
zqW^b0gR*12D-T<iCpJl|zTVST?dz>C{Ab;iPhaI7oxCG*9SqwU7#J8lUHx2G);T3K
F0RZZVwQ2wW

diff --git a/img/layout/settings.png b/img/layout/settings.png
index 8821c353e5d38e23e1f32a29dc0e62369dc0c148..ff650ecb0b0eaa766a055ec8d5f31648539177d6 100644
GIT binary patch
delta 671
zcmdnYyq$G|N<B-llV=DA2M0$DM@k0+0|RG)M`SSr1MhVZW^~e+UBSS>AX(xXQ4*Y=
zR#Ki=l*&+EUaps!mtCBkSdglhUz9%kosAR&1CxoTi(`mIZ|~&u*}{$@$M<jE!O7})
z!6ldHh5dr95d!>{S|Uf-{;*eZKM6Xs^!OuPMe#r(|9Z357?y+Uo+W9_>z=^UwX<be
ziyC9OYNGgN`$?R}=bLx$I41V%0k`p<^U3$hpYe8Zq<eBq6m*)f{!HbZru_>&G`Bzh
z{8Nh|)j-0Ab3xqt?R*Y1&p%%sbShUN<hgTC@xIfR%U_mc6`re}QydkLZ#H}8zpCjS
z5`v9_f($x0xBWG)7wU{T#@bYz=dU(d`t<43>zEjNHb!oYxHCP-$%|95WzF^1?KgAE
z^k<)aclGsGXT=ttPpwW5gOw%<BywBW+Sb0`rMGjP_s^O-`2$uB)(m;f6?4u%w`cn~
zdGcg_M_HNUCvR-?ZT$83AIE`Pk8+uJ+<yPvJ@H!MoSsWBOWw5~yqHm+A`qB-(Oj@r
zzW;dDjNI+FvriRRY+=q1@;Z{VG5dLJoQ>RmsWkTHMrH<WhO(@!QHM=@KW*KaanR)K
zS%vu3SEU%r7;N^qxVSU)oqD>-%Z2|>+5O0ArThod|9?miI;DF|f?>h!w{@zErZfCI
zbFjc7rps-yy@>11qKTFQPJbTFslV@|HhCTs!_JsK^Vw&Um71Pc&P$EFwutrgCY|%2
zZIql=U$ydE8uaD7jLYJS%a;bdOh`_Cymi&8=vm85c@8TaHt@K-rES$J{Yx*utPWaP
zBGBnFkNvLxzOTv*+Zi@wZT;nTz4TJ)T&=06q8WG&lrpSbVDU%%ANR2vTn$_H|8;V?
eFLCZs9kY^?2>(ot^d}4q3=E#GelF{r5}E)YOD%r@

delta 388
zcmdnax|w-`3O`$tx4R3&e-K=-clqRrh7$GcC7!;n?6+A21f_))Z+sD8U|@9cba4!^
zI6Zf=p*ORmNXvdv(V(RQ+5f${tm_>QBs^3+BpR+_=^@OLyDmUEVu`olY;D!9ZERoF
zJ6bh1a^7MWmFa$?Ce3^B^np#=^Y5S8d$X2X>}!>5g8>iYgpf%l8<P3?uVzi<ypm<=
zeygnB(37{f@ZnK&#;CQ|3?`^_-rlkGWUOcH-=hve$Lsbp94WL3x*J#~!zjSgD7^E$
z!#hToz?P4D_A+ai{bbwHSiJilL)U>-r_GN^xa)XX{rlSP>}lzFtZz>5&kXNdu9uEa
z5#pY7=4o)}>gT#^JQ8P3cTHPxd-p@>!@q9zsCfRKv@YxUh644MSL~1YC%oL>&Y>fn
zyzh^fmE^jQj0<A)`fnHaxmiir^1S|h)$}CKrN!5;{q$ODv}VE09IJ_K=`YVHm#OOB
us8G_JzwG6cTnkfkZ!X)$$(fc6_OiY)?C!^Am@+UhFnGH9xvX<aXaWE}uBe;<

diff --git a/templates/layout.admin.php b/templates/layout.admin.php
index e20b7e48ec..9f5a175605 100644
--- a/templates/layout.admin.php
+++ b/templates/layout.admin.php
@@ -17,10 +17,9 @@
 			<a href="<?php echo link_to('', 'index.php'); ?>" title="" id="owncloud"><img src="<?php echo image_path('', 'owncloud-logo-small-white.png'); ?>" alt="ownCloud" /></a>
 
 			<ul id="metanav">
-				<li><a href="<?php echo link_to('', 'index.php'); ?>" title=""><img src="<?php echo image_path('', 'layout/back.png'); ?>"></a></li>
-				<li><a href="<?php echo link_to('settings', 'index.php'); ?>" title=""><img src="<?php echo image_path('', 'layout/settings.png'); ?>"></a></li>
-				<li><a href="<?php echo link_to('help', 'index.php'); ?>" title=""><img src="<?php echo image_path('', 'layout/help.png'); ?>"></a></li>
-				<li><a href="<?php echo link_to('', 'index.php?logout=true'); ?>" title=""><img src="<?php echo image_path('', 'layout/logout.png'); ?>"></a></li>
+				<li><a href="<?php echo link_to('', 'index.php'); ?>" title="Back"><img src="<?php echo image_path('', 'layout/back.png'); ?>"></a></li>
+				<li><a href="<?php echo link_to('settings', 'index.php'); ?>" title="Settings"><img src="<?php echo image_path('', 'layout/settings.png'); ?>"></a></li>
+				<li><a href="<?php echo link_to('', 'index.php?logout=true'); ?>" title="Log out"><img src="<?php echo image_path('', 'layout/logout.png'); ?>"></a></li>
 			</ul>
 		</div>
 
diff --git a/templates/layout.user.php b/templates/layout.user.php
index 1ab2d01d9d..b03fca9308 100644
--- a/templates/layout.user.php
+++ b/templates/layout.user.php
@@ -17,12 +17,8 @@
 			<a href="<?php echo link_to('', 'index.php'); ?>" title="" id="owncloud"><img src="<?php echo image_path('', 'owncloud-logo-small-white.png'); ?>" alt="ownCloud" /></a>
 
 			<ul id="metanav">
-				<?php if( OC_APP::getActiveNavigationEntry() == "help" ): ?>
-					<li><a href="<?php echo link_to('', 'index.php'); ?>" title=""><img src="<?php echo image_path('', 'layout/back.png'); ?>"></a></li>
-				<?php endif; ?>
-				<li><a href="<?php echo link_to('settings', 'index.php'); ?>" title=""><img src="<?php echo image_path('', 'layout/settings.png'); ?>"></a></li>
-				<li><a href="<?php echo link_to('help', 'index.php'); ?>" title=""><img src="<?php echo image_path('', 'layout/help.png'); ?>"></a></li>
-				<li><a href="<?php echo link_to('', 'index.php'); ?>?logout=true" title=""><img src="<?php echo image_path('', 'layout/logout.png'); ?>"></a></li>
+				<li><a href="<?php echo link_to('settings', 'index.php'); ?>" title="Settings"><img src="<?php echo image_path('', 'layout/settings.png'); ?>"></a></li>
+				<li><a href="<?php echo link_to('', 'index.php'); ?>?logout=true" title="Log out"><img src="<?php echo image_path('', 'layout/logout.png'); ?>"></a></li>
 			</ul>
 		</div>
 
-- 
GitLab